>> What's the idea behind
>> #echo 'deb http://deb.debian.org/debian bullseye main' >>/etc/apt/sources.list
>> That's already in sources.list, so I'm not sure what this shows?
>
>At one point I thought I needed it - maybe all I needed was "apt-get update"..

Yes, that's needed. There's no old pre fetched package list, because it'd be outdated anyway, and work *sometimes* for
somepackages... They're also not small (image size influences job start speed heavily). 


>> > 9d0f03d3450 wip: cirrus: code coverage
>>
>> I don't think it's good to just unconditionally reference the master branch
>> here. It'll do bogus stuff once 15 is branched off. It works for cfbot, but
>> not other uses.
>
>That's only used for filtering changed files.  It uses git diff --cherry-pick
>postgres/master..., which would *try* to avoid showing anything which is also
>in master.

The point is that master is not a relevant point of comparison when a commit in the 14 branch is tested.
